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
248558 23790 14700284
152865333 1830
152865333 1830
6795 8384 18553909694
All about undefined
Interested in learning more?
152865333 1830
6795 8384 18553909694
See more
336646237 11152099940
659305127 6579 2082
See more
706936878 7506553 553421
34958 58908 25688450 64 1913833
See more